Glen Lake Board of Education is asking for the community to come together and share feedback on the recent November 2023 Bond Proposal.

“We are listening so that our district can move forward with the right plan for our community. Food will be provided at the event. Please join us to share your input and have the opportunity to tour our facilities,” Glen Lake Board of Education said in a statement last week.

The listening sessions materialized after the board’s $35 million proposal to improve facilities and new construction failed in November by a vote of 1,119 to 963.
